2.Report on Revenue as of April 30, 2016

The Commission on POST is financed through a Special Fund known as the Peace Officer Training Fund. The Commission is provided a monthly update on the revenue collected by the State Controller’s Office and distributed by the California Department of Finance. POST depends on this revenue to perform its legal obligations to the State of California. Revenues collected through April 30, 2016 are 20.3% lower than last year’s revenue through April 30, 2015.

Report on Request to Contract for a POST Internal Organizational Study

In June 2015, the Commission approved the updated POST Strategic Plan.  One of the four main goals of that plan was to Increase Efficiency in POST Systems and Operations.

 

The first strategy under this goal is B.3.1 - Complete an organizational workload study of POST utilizing internal resources. In subsequent meetings with the POST Strategic Plan Implementation Team, a determination was made that this project should be done in collaboration with an outside expert in order to have a more global view during the study process.  This contractor will work in partnership with a designated POST staff member from Management Counseling/Leadership Bureau (MCLB) who is experienced and regularly conducts organizational studies for California law enforcement agencies.  The project is estimated to take one year from its initiation to the final report, for a cost not to exceed $75,000.
